About the producer

This chateau owes its name to the establishment of the Order of Knights of the Hospital of Saint John of Jerusalem. The chateau La Commanderie is located south of Pomerol in Saint-Emilion in the area of ​​Figeac. Of the 6 hectares of vines, 80% are planted in Merlot on a sandy-clay soil.

About the wine

Best drunk young, this wine has a good, dark colour, and a menthol bouquet, mixed with jammy aromas of red fruit and chocolate. It is silky, well-rounded and harmonious.
